Location - LISMORE DRIVE is a quiet cul-de-sac and is approached from Osmaston Road and therefore is within easy reach for all amenities. Harborne High Street is readily accessible as is the Queen Elizabeth Medical Complex and Birmingham Universitty. There are excellent public transport facilities and schools for children of all ages.
Description - 42 LISMORE DRIVE is a particularly spacious three bedroomed detached residence that has been extended by the present owners and fully merits an internal inspection. Benefitting from gas central heating together with double glazing. The accommodation comprises enclosed porch, extended lounge/dining room, fitted kitchen, whilst at first floor level there are three bedrooms and a well appointed bathroom. To complement the property is an integral garage and enclosed rear garden.
